Today, what AccuWeather calls a triple threat March megastorm is affecting nearly 200 million people across the United States, dumping feet of snow in the upper Midwest and threatening mid-Atlantic cities like Baltimore and Washington, D.C., with high winds and possibly tornadoes.
And that's before an unprecedented heat wave bakes the western United States later this week, which weather analyst Colin McCarthy said ranks among the most extraordinary heat waves the United States will ever see. Palm Springs is forecasted to hit 111 degrees this Friday, seven degrees warmer than any other March Day Palm Springs has ever seen.

That's linkedin.com slash MBD. Terms and conditions may apply. On an Oscars night that gave us one award after another after another, it was fitting that one battle after another, a saga about an ex-revolutionary searching for his daughter, won Best Picture in the end.
Paul Thomas Anderson also won Best Director for the film, giving one of the most renowned filmmakers of our time his first trophies. In the other major categories, Michael B. Jordan won Best Actor for Sinners, defeating Timothee Chalamet and Marty Supreme. Jessie Buckley won Best Actress for making us all sob in Hamnet.

I won't actually go in and tell you what the EPG stands for. It's Sterified Propoxylated Glycerol. Okay, so it was actually a little bit easier than I expected. Well done, Neil. But basically, EPG is designed so that fewer calories are absorbed into the body.
It basically moves through the body without being digested, which is a little freaky because you might think that leads to some diarrhea issues, which has been reported if you consume excess amounts of EPG.
But that is why you're seeing a difference between what the bomb calorimeter showed and what actually David claims is in the bars is because this substance does not get absorbed in the way that other substances would. So This is kind of like the thing that unlocked David's insane macros. When this first came out, I remember people saying, how can this possibly be true?
You cannot fit that much protein in a bar with this little amount of fat, with this little amount of calories. But EPG is at the center of it. That is why you see this class action lawsuit. And that's why Rahal said, anytime you're on the forefront of innovation, there's confusion. We stand by our product fully. And a lot of other people are standing by their product.
So Rahal sold RXBAR to Kellogg's for $600 million back in 2017, and then went back in the lab and then rolled out David in 2024. Just in the, I mean, it's been a year and a half. It's grown into a 725 million business. They're looking at new product lines. So there's, yes, there's been some backlash, but it's already a bigger company than RX Bar by leaps and bounds.
